Kevin O'Riordan wrote:
> Thinking of installing it on a Sun box (from what 
> I can tell Gentoo and Debian are the only 2 current distributions 
> available for SPARC), but don't want to find support/updates etc. 
> dropped for it straight afterwards.

I think you'd be better off hitching your wagon to Debian if you're 
installing onto SPARC. Debian was on SPARC yesterday, is on SPARC today, 
and chances are good that it'll still be on SPARC tomorrow.
